Output 576a4d656b7580724cb0fa7cd0d7faf3bf2035669c19dba336d2dd44486c67f3:4

value
10562321
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34328b0153a407f26d4d63bae6a807ab4019fcd9 OP_EQUALVERIFY OP_CHECKSIG
address
15kzgmHpzkWgmL4KmzHfGFkFQ97fAZ5uSj
transaction
576a4d656b7580724cb0fa7cd0d7faf3bf2035669c19dba336d2dd44486c67f3
confirmations
159410
spent
true